For a clogged sink in Minneapolis, a plumber will typically start by using a plunger or drain snake to dislodge the obstruction. If the clog is deeper, they may use an auger or even a hydro-jetting system for thorough cleaning. They'll also inspect the trap and pipes for any accumulated debris or damage. The goal is to restore proper drainage efficiently and prevent future blockages in your Minneapolis kitchen or bathroom.

When a plumber installs a toilet in Minneapolis, they'll shut off the water supply and remove the old fixture. They meticulously inspect the toilet flange and wax ring, replacing them if necessary to ensure a watertight seal against the drainpipe. New flexible supply lines are typically installed for optimal performance. The new toilet is then carefully set, leveled, and secured, with all connections tested to confirm a leak-free and efficient flush for your Minneapolis bathroom.
